The growing demand for "flexibility" of production, reduces the possibility of using a fully automatic systems. For many operations in particular body shop and assembly, has increased the role of manual operations and, consequently, the need to develop highly ergonomic workstations in order to:
· comply with the regulations;
· eliminate / prevent diseases from work;
· improve the process reliability;
· improve and ensure the quality of manual processes and products.
The analysis of ergonomic workplace can be achieved through experimental tools and simulation software tools. In particular, it can act in two distinct phases of the development process:
· on the existing working line, where the optimization in this case is to improve the impact of new tools and equipment and undertaken only where there are critical macro;
· in the design phase, where through specific tools for the movement analysis (to objectify the operators movement within a pilot workplace) integrated with those of virtual reality is possible the design of the production process by optimizing cycle time, method and ergonomics to improve the quality of the final process.
